Rev. Bartholomew F. Killilea, Pastor 1906-1909
St. Bridget's Parish
Fr. Killilea was pastor of St. Bridge's Parish in 1906-1909. It was during his pastorate that the present rectory was built. Named a Vicar Forane with the title of Very Reverend in 1920.

Rev. George A. Hamilton - Rev. John A. Conlin
St. Bridget's Parish
Rev. George A. Hamilton said the first Mass at Assabet Village in 1850. He was the Pastor of the Great Milford Parish (Milford to Assabet) 1850-54. Left Photo
Rev. John A. Conlin built the first St. Bridget's Church on Main Street in 1865. It was…
